Last two years tax returns...and income this year

When the mortgage lender asks for the previous 2 years tax returns are they using that income for the basis of what amount of loan you qualify for? The reason I ask is because I'm wondering what happens in the situation where someone made the same amount for last 2 years but this year their income is 10,000 more annually? Do they use your current income?

When a mortgage lenders asks for the last 2 years tax returns and year to date income, it usually means that the borrower is self employed.  The income used to qualify is averaged.

They are also looking for non-reimbursed business expenses you may have taken as deductions.  They subtract these from your income when qualifying.
